    Executive Dining Room

    Manuscripts

    Approx. 20 items. File includes a range of memos, lists and announcements related to the establishment and use of the Times' executive dining room (a.k.a. Picasso Room). Some specific subjects are initial list of those eligible, subsequent expanded lists (1962-63), prices, rules related to use of the facility.

    Guest book for Times Mirror Corporate

    Manuscripts

    Large blue leatherette book, "Times Mirror" on cover, used as guest signature book for visitors to the Times Mirror corporate offices and likely the Publisher's Office. Starts with the dedication of the Times Mirror building on May 23, 1973 and ends with Newspaper Seminar on September 17, 1976. CONSERVATION NOTE: Paper block is separated from the binding. Please open with caution and use book stand.
